Does 3D rendering work?

0

Officially: No. Unofficially: 3D might work depending on your card type and lots of other things. At the moment the rawhide dri (mesa) is version 6.5.2. This means the nouveau_dri module is not installed and so no 3D operations will be accelerated. If you install an unofficial mesa snapshot from here , some simple 3D applications might work, for instance glxgears works at about 300fps on a GeForce Go 7300. [1] You can tell if you are using DRI using glxinfo | grep direct. For some very new cards, an updated DRM snapshot will be required. Fedora already patches in the latest nouveau drm functionality into the kernel SRPM, and the patch will be updated as new cards are supported. Texture mapping will also not work (requries TTM), so don’t expect you can run any OpenGL games just yet. Please don’t file bugs in the fedora bugzilla if you are using unofficial or snapshot packages.
